This piece to the left is a Geometric piece of art done by Tilman. It is very easy to identify this as geometric due to the pattern of triangles and diamonds pieced together and repeated often. Tilman uses different values of colors to distinguish the shapes apart from each other. For example the three values of blue that he uses you can decipher them from the other shapes. There isn’t really any figure-ground relationship here due to the fact that you cant really tell what he was intending on making besides a group of triangles and diamonds. The picture below is a organic street painting done by Brad Eastman in Sydney, Australia and i found to be a pretty good work of art. There is some figure-ground relationship as you can see eyes,  some water and a rainbow. I felt this was organic due to all of the different curves and misplacement of things that really go together nicely. I think the value of colors go very well together as he used many values of range and blues to really attract the eyes as you look at it. All of the colors seem to be vibrant colors that are connected well to made your eyes really have to look at the whole picture before leaving. I found this painting on http://www.beastman.com.au/.
